Alabama Code § 45-2-234.40

Receipt of Badge and Firearm
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
Any individual employed by the Baldwin County Sheriff’s office as a law enforcement officer, including the sheriff, for a period of 10 years or more who retires from the department in good standing may receive from the sheriff, without cost, a retired badge, a retired commission card, and a firearm, provided the firearm is furnished by the department.
